English: **C18 or earlier bridge crossing the Afon Prysor that carried the original packhorse route between Harlech and Maentwrog.
Narrow bridge of roughly coursed rubble masonry, a wide segmental arch of rough stone voussoirs; no parapet. A Grade II Listed Building, Listed as a C18 bridge, a rare survivor of a pack-horse bridge, notable for the width of its span, and its narrow form, without parapets.
